Cycling to Beijing
Krzystof Skok set out on a journey on 8th of April 2008, from Sopot to Beijing. He traverse with his bike more than 12 000 km. Today is the end of his travel on a day of Olympic Games opening, Krzysztof Skok came finally to Beijing. He is going to spend there about 5 days and then a way back to Poland - also with bicycle and train awaits him.
Krzysztof Przemyslaw Skok, a student of the University of Gdansk set out on a journey from our country on April 8th in a solitary bicycle escapade. He is traveling already for almost 121 days and he had a lot of adventures in Lithuania, Latvia, Russia, Mongolia and northern China.
Krzysztof is writting his travel journal, and here is a fragment of one of his entries: "Hi, because of the Olimpics all Internet cafes are closed! And since Friday there is always someone behind me, riding with me, and whenever I disappear out of their sight, immediately rumor has it that I am a USA spy! Pure paranoia. I have 200 km to Beijing and loads of problems. Yesterday, they even controlled a toilet after me, and people give me food, through 'my bodyguards "…
